Simply put a solar panel works by allowing photons or particles of light to knock electrons free from atoms generating a flow of electricity.
This flow travels in a circuit of wires that connect groups of solar panels called arrays.
Solar panels work by converting sunlight into electricity at the atomic scale.
Solar panels work by absorbing sunlight with photovoltaic cells generating direct current dc energy and then converting it to usable alternating current ac energy with the help of inverter technology.
Ac energy then flows through the home s electrical panel and is distributed accordingly.
